35 /**
36  * struct ucsi_operations - UCSI I/O operations
37  * @read: Read operation
38  * @sync_write: Blocking write operation
39  * @async_write: Non-blocking write operation
40  * @update_altmodes: Squashes duplicate DP altmodes
41  *
42  * Read and write routines for UCSI interface. @sync_write must wait for the
43  * Command Completion Event from the PPM before returning, and @async_write must
44  * return immediately after sending the data to the PPM.
45  */
46 struct ucsi_operations {
47 	int (*read)(struct ucsi *ucsi, unsigned int offset,
48 		    void *val, size_t val_len);
49 	int (*sync_write)(struct ucsi *ucsi, unsigned int offset,
50 			  const void *val, size_t val_len);
51 	int (*async_write)(struct ucsi *ucsi, unsigned int offset,
52 			   const void *val, size_t val_len);
53 	bool (*update_altmodes)(struct ucsi *ucsi, struct ucsi_altmode *orig,
54 				struct ucsi_altmode *updated);
55 };
